Chelmos violet

Viola chelmea

Chelmos violet (lat. Viola chelmea) is a perennial herbaceous plant belonging to the Violaceae family. It is an endemic species native to the mountainous regions of Greece, primarily found in rocky, high-altitude limestone habitats.

Chelmos violet

The plant thrives in cool, alpine climates. In cultivation, it requires a position with bright but filtered light, particularly protected from the intense heat of the mid-afternoon sun, which can cause significant stress to its foliage.

The soil requirements are strict: the medium must be exceptionally well-drained, porous, and gritty. A neutral to alkaline pH level is ideal to replicate its native rocky environment, ensuring the root system remains healthy and free from stagnation.

Botanically, Viola chelmea is characterized by a compact rosette of leaves. Its growth habit is perfectly adapted to crevices and stony substrates, where it utilizes its small size to compete for limited moisture and nutrients in harsh mountain conditions.

Its ornamental utility is primarily restricted to specialized rock garden collections and alpine frames. Due to its rarity and specific ecological needs, it is highly sought after by enthusiasts of rare mountain flora for its delicate appearance and resilience to cold.

The primary threats to Viola chelmea in cultivation include fungal pathogens such as root rot and gray mold, which are predominantly caused by excessive moisture and poor air circulation around the crown.

Common garden pests such as aphids, spider mites, and leaf-chewing insects can pose risks. Early monitoring and the use of appropriate horticultural soaps or systemic insecticides are recommended to maintain plant vitality.

Slugs and snails are particularly attracted to the tender foliage during the spring growing season. Protective measures, including physical barriers or baits, should be implemented to prevent significant structural damage.

Preventive maintenance involves removing dead plant material to minimize the risk of pathogen spread. Keeping the crown of the plant dry by using a top dressing of fine grit is a standard practice for this species.

Proper water management is essential for long-term health; irrigation should be applied cautiously, ensuring the substrate dries slightly between waterings to prevent the development of root-borne pathogens.
